Membrane proteins (MPs) play essential roles in virtually every aspect of cell biology and are crucial targets for therapeutic intervention. But they’re notoriously difficult to work with: traditional detergent-based extraction methods often destabilise the proteins and disrupt their lipid environments.
Enter BzAM Terpolymers: an optimised alternative to standard SMA copolymers. These polymers are produced via controlled polymerization techniques, with well-defined properties and form nanoscale discs that preserve the structural and functional integrity of MPs, opening new avenues for structural biology, drug discovery, and biotechnology.ion text goes here

What Makes BzAM Polymers Unique?
The BzAM series is designed as an advanced, tunable platform:
Tunable amphiphilicity: Adjust the hydrophobic/hydrophilic balance to suit different targets.
Controlled molecular weight and distribution: Achieve reproducibility and consistent performance.
Industry-relevant design: Built to outperform traditional SMA while offering greater experimental flexibility and advanced functionalities.
This rational design approach allows researchers to explore how polymer properties affect protein extraction and downstream approaches systematically.

Efficient membrane solubilization using BzAM terpolymers, including the bacterial ABC transporter Sav1866.
Hydrophobicity–efficiency correlation: The more hydrophobic the polymer, the better its solubilization performance for this target.
Reinforces the importance of tailored polymer design for targeted membrane protein applications.
